IRMA LUCILLA (SALAZAR) PALACIOS Irma passed away peacefully on June 18, 2016. She spent her last days surrounded by family and friends who loved her dearly. She was born on January 5, 1940 to Santiago (Sandy) and Rita Salazar. She is preceded in death by her husband, Danny Palacios (the love of...
